Punjab Schools to Retain Saturday Holiday Despite Winter Schedule Update

The Punjab Education Department has finalized a new winter schedule for schools, set to take effect from October 20, 2025, and continue until March 2026.

Reports on social media suggested that the provincial government might end the weekly Saturday holiday. However, Education Minister Rana Sikandar Hayat clarified that schools will continue to observe Saturdays as off days.

The updated schedule has been submitted to Chief Minister Maryam Nawaz Sharif for formal approval, and the revised school hours will be implemented once her signature is received.
